Improved route to a diphenoxide-based precursor for CVD of parylene AF-4

  • 1. Munich University of Applied Sciences
  • 2. Massachusetts Institute of Technology

Description

In this work, we present an easy synthesis of a alternative precursor for CVD of parylene AF-4 to the widely used standard, Octafluoro[2.2]paracyclophane. The standard precursor suffers from uncertainties in its supply chain and its synthesis is of low yield. A comparison between different reaction parameters and solvents are being discussed by means of thermal, laboratory scale and microwave assisted reactions and qNMR studies.
